Exporting Get-NcEfficiency output to an Excel workbook

by Frequent Contributor on ‎2012-10-31 12:10 PM

Get-NcEfficiency, released with Toolkit 2.2, provides an easy mechanism for gathering efficiency information for clustered Data ONTAP.  The Export-NcEfficiencyXls.ps1 script attached to this post exports the efficiency data from Get-NcEfficiency into an Excel workbook.

Usage:

.\Export-NcEfficiencyXls.ps1 [-WorkbookFilename <String>] [-Unit <Int64>] [-Controller <NcController>] [-Quiet]

The WorkbookFilename parameter specifies the name to give the saved Excel workbook.  If not specified, the workbook will be saved as "<controller>_nc_efficency_<timestamp>.xlsx" in the current directory.

The Unit parameter specifies the units to use when displaying values.  Possible values: 1KB, 1MB, 1GB, 1PB.  The default is 1MB.

The Controller parameter specifies the NcController object to run Get-NcEfficiency against.  If not specified, the value in $global:CurrentNcController is used.

The Quiet switch prevents the launch of Excel when the script completes.

Feel free to modify the script to meet your own needs, just be sure to share anything cool with the community!

Comments

Hi,

 

Great report. How would I add a column to record the snap delta please?

Warning!

This NetApp Community is public and open website that is indexed by search engines such as Google. Participation in the NetApp Community is voluntary. All content posted on the NetApp Community is publicly viewable and available. This includes the rich text editor which is not encrypted for https.

In accordance to our Code of Conduct and Community Terms of Use DO NOT post or attach the following:

  • Software files (compressed or uncompressed)
  • Files that require an End User License Agreement (EULA)
  • Confidential information
  • Personal data you do not want publicly available
  • Another’s personally identifiable information
  • Copyrighted materials without the permission of the copyright owner

Files and content that do not abide by the Community Terms of Use or Code of Conduct will be removed. Continued non-compliance may result in NetApp Community account restrictions or termination.